    The bactericidal and/or bacteriostatic effe cts at 30 and 55C of a

    glucose-fructose s yrup (25% alkali conversion, pH 4 .8, 68 % solids) were

    evaluated . The s yrup was inoculated with known concentrations of the

    foll owing microorganisms : Saccharamyces rouxii, xero l illic fungi-M-2 ;

    S . aureus, L . mesenteroides, E . coli, B. sub-tiTis, vege tative cel is) ;

    and Ps . fluorscens. After the im t al number of organisms was de termined,

    the seal ed tubes Tiere incubated at 30 and 55C . The number of viable cell s

    were determined at periodic intervals up to 10 days . The results in the

    following table indicate that the syrup s tored under the se conditions

    was bactericidal to all organisms e xcept B . subtilis (at 30C) and M-2 .

    The syrup was bacteriostatic to B . subtilis at 30C and M-2, in that a

    two slope curve was observed ; a fast initial rate (up to 3 days) foll owed

    by a bacteriostatic effe ct (slight reduction in viable numbers ) .
